Why Attend Phoenix Job Fairs?

One of the main benefits of attending job fairs in Phoenix is the opportunity to meet with a large number of potential employers in a single location. Rather than having to apply to each company individually, job seekers can take advantage of the convenience of meeting with multiple employers at one event. This not only saves time but also provides job seekers with a broader range of job opportunities to consider.

Additionally, job fairs allow job seekers to learn about new industries and positions they may not have considered previously. By speaking with employers and learning about their companies, job seekers can broaden their horizons and discover new career paths.

Job fairs also offer the opportunity to network with other job seekers and professionals in the same field. By connecting with other professionals and exchanging information, job seekers can gain valuable insights and tips for their job search.

Tips for Making the Most Out of Your Phoenix Job Fair Experience

  1. Dress Professionally – When attending a job fair, it’s important to dress professionally to make a good first impression. Dress as if you were going to a job interview, and make sure your attire is appropriate for the type of job you are seeking.
  2. Bring Copies of Your Resume – Be sure to bring plenty of copies of your resume to hand out to potential employers. Make sure your resume is up-to-date and tailored to the positions you are interested in.
  3. Research Participating Companies – Prior to attending the job fair, research the companies that will be in attendance. This will allow you to prepare specific questions for each company and show that you are knowledgeable and interested in their business.
  4. Practice Your Elevator Pitch – Be prepared to give a brief elevator pitch to each employer you speak with. This should be a concise summary of your skills and experience, highlighting your qualifications for the positions you are interested in.
  5. Follow Up – After the job fair, be sure to follow up with any employers you spoke with. This can be done through email or by sending a thank-you note. It’s important to keep the conversation going and show that you are interested in the opportunities discussed.

Top Phoenix Job Fairs

  1. Phoenix Job Fair – This annual job fair is held at the Phoenix Airport Marriott and features a wide range of employers from various industries.
  2. Career Connectors – Career Connectors is a local organization that hosts regular job fairs throughout the Phoenix area, connecting job seekers with potential employers.
  3. Diversity Career Group – This organization hosts job fairs throughout the year, with a focus on connecting diverse candidates with employers who value diversity and inclusion.
  4. Arizona@Work – Arizona@Work is a statewide program that hosts job fairs and provides job search assistance to job seekers throughout Arizona.
